This was my home away from home during 2000 to 2002. At that time the room rate negotiated by my travel agent was US$120 per night. On check-in I was upgraded to the executive floors. The management and staff are very helpful. If you stay on the executive floors (15th floor or above) the private lounge is a treat with free drinks and snacks. During my visits the exchange rate worked very well in my favour meaning that a beer from the in room mini bar cost about R3 (US$0.50) a bottle although I don't know what the situation is now. by sebblit7 This used to be the Sheraton. It's the same old hotel I remember but it's had a face lift, new carpets, new front desks. Free wireless internet connection in the lobby area, just ask the check in staff for a voucher. Currently the voucher is free, this may change soon. One warning about this and all hotels in Zim. Do not charge anything to your room, if you do you will be made to pay for it in US$ at the "official rate" on check out. The official rate is currently US$1 = Zim$250 so if you you have a meal for Zim$2500 you will pay US$10 on check-out The unofficial rate is US$1 = Zim$1100 so if you pay cash for a Zim$2500 meal you will have effectively paid US$2.30 for the meal. My room had two single beds, an electronic safe, an unstocked minibar, TV, telephone, bath and shower. The aircon wasn't working effectively. Room service was a lot faster than I remeber it, about 5 minutes for a drink and about 20 minutes for a sandwich. Like most of the wonderful people in Zimbabwe, the staff are extremely polite and friendly. I booked my room through Zimbabwe International Travel and Tours and they gave me a rate of US$90/night including taxes and full English b/fast: Obviously this rate may change but it's a dam site cheaper than what a walk in will cost.
